Running the Agent
The Agent program was automatically started when you installed it, and it was installed to
restart automatically if the system is restarted or it stops for any reason.
The installation script places an entry in the “/etc/inittab” file to implement automatic
execution of the Agent. The tag field in the file is “steam”.
NOTE: The HACMP cluster software installation script does not place an entry into the
“/etc/inittab” file. During operation of the HACMP as a cluster, Agent failure is handled by
means of the HACMP event scripts.
Reconfiguring the Agent
Use the configuration script to reconfigure the the Agent after you have completed the
install. Start the configuration script manually by entering the command
<agent install
directory>/steam/bin/
config.sh. You can also start the configuration script by entering
the command
<agent directory>/stgwks_aix.sh and choosing Option 3 from the
Command Console Agent Installation and Configuration menu.
